An efficient Ir-catalyzed biomimetic method for photoisomerization of cyclopropane in lathyrane-type diterpenes is reported. Lathyrane diterpenes featuring the -fused cyclopropane (-) were successfully prepared from -cyclopropane lathyranes (-) in excellent yields by this stereochemical permutations strategy, which first verified the biogenesis relationship between the lathyrane isomers. Moreover, could further convert into another -isomer . The present work provides a convenient route for easy access of naturally rare 12()--cyclopropane lathyranes.
